    Haven't posted in a while but things are still slowly moving .

    0_1491513724094_IMG_5549.JPG

    The wheel has been with the builder for a week now so hoping to have it back soon.

    Ordered the wrong front yz calliper doh!! So sending that back and ordering another. They calliper carry is wider on a 98 then the 97. My forks are 98 🙃.

    The yz exhaust has arrived as well but I forgot to take a photo. It doesn't quite fit might need a little bit of heat and some bending to make it work but it's not to far off.

                                    @calum Yes it but i think u can get a decent YZ125 for the same as a DTR these days Cal, mind you I guess its fun modifying them and having it how you want it. YZ front end with DTR shock will stiff front rubbish soft as rear end a stiffer DTX rear shock would be better and easy to fit no mods. 18 inch WR250/450 etc enduro rear excel rim would offer a better tyre choice rather than a 19 YZ motox rim also WR250/450 front wheel has a cable speedo drive unlike the YZ not a criticism just would be the same but easier.
